meninges

meninges

pl. n. (sing. meninx) the three membranous layers that provide a protective cover for the brain and spinal cord. They consist of a tough outer dura mater, a middle arachnoid mater, and a thin, transparent pia mater, which fits over the various contours and fissures of the cerebral cortex.
